Has anyone made any trips to Sugar Lake in Wright County, MN this year? Sugar is the closest lake to my home so I typically hit it fairly often. I haven't caught a fish out there this year yet and have only moved one small 30" fish back in early July. In the last 4 trips I have made, I haven't seen a fish and the pressure from the Muskie guys feels lower than usual. Did something happen out there? I'm sure the fish are there but I can't get them moving.

With the lack of rain over the last 15 days, the lake is exceptionally clear but you would think that you could still move something. I've hit deep, topwaters, shallows, weeds. About the only spot I haven't tried are the mid-lake humps.

The temp is at the highest I have seen it at 76 degrees which is still 5 degrees below where it was at last year. I moved a lot of fish on that lake last year and pulled a 50" and 36" out of there.

Hey guys.. been fortunate enough to work here in monti most of the time these last 3years, I feel I know the lake pretty well. haven't been out the last 2 weeks cuz of gearing up for the PMTT this weekend, but last time out stuck a 42 on top water "creepin it", pretty slow at dark... i moved a handful and got a few to go slow rolling swim baits off the deeper edges(kick n minnow, shadzilla), also gliding in big rubber, (helli dog, tubes).. ive learned this time of year that wherever "your" edge is where you like to cast, go another quarter cast or so towards deeper water with the boat....hope this helps! keep castin! blue 617 150evenrude
